Griffin Posted - 13 Sep 2016 : 12:52:34
Your target this week is the Togwon-ni nuclear power station. This is much deeper into enemy territory than he have been for some time so expect more ground and air threats to be a factor.



The above image shows your route. Note the airborne threats in the area and the newly found AAA and SA-11 sites found by the friendly FA-18 flying up there at the moment.

Falcon and Fury shall take off from Nowhere (Yechon) AB and Cowboy from Chongju.

Package 18198
Cowboy 1 is a four ship strike flight. MS is for the Reactor, Admin Building, Processor and last transformer in the list to be destroyed. PS will be awarded if the Reactor and the Processor are destroyed.

Falcon 1 is the four ship escort and Package Commander, tasked to protect the strike flights.
IDA will be from this flight.
MS no AA losses to the strike flights, PS one loss to the strike flight.

Fury 1 is a four ship SEAD flight. MS is no radar SAM or radar AAA losses to the package, PS is a maximum of two similar losses.

Time on Target
TOT for Cowboy 1 is 07:00hrs at FL220. IDM 1, VHF 1, tacan 11/74
TOT for Falcon 1 is 06:57hrs at FL280. IDM 2, VHF 2, tacan 16/79
TOT for Fury 1 is 06:59hrs at FL270. IDM 3, VHF 3, tacan 21/84

Flight path is fixed for mutual support.

The weather is still on the change and is expected to remain poor for the next few hours. Choose your weapons accordingly.

Good Hunting

Fisty Posted - 19 Sep 2016 : 20:21:36
Flight Role: Strike

Cowboy11: "Fisty" AA=0 AG=0 RTB (Crashed on landing)
Cowboy12: "Mango" AA=0 AG=0 RTB (Crashed on landing)
Cowboy13: "Sabre" AA=0 AG=0 TECH
Cowboy14: "Poppy" AA=0 AG=0 RTB

On Ingress FL picked up a singleton contact about 20 left of scope at 60 miles NW. This would have factored on the flight plan, so seeing that the Escort was about 20 miles to the east and east of flight plan, FL soft locked and declared. AWACS confirmed the contact as hostile, so FL requested Escort to investigate. Shortly after, the contact faded, but may have been one of the 29s causing all the havoc later on.
Sabre then reported a Tech with his throttle, so had to exit. No.3 (AI) was sent home.
The rest of the flight then loitered about 20Nm south of the FLOT, but caught the attention of a couple of 29s on the RWR, which also seemed to jump into the inner circle on FL's RWR. This, along with ESC FL's directive to retrograde south meant we were well ahead of the curve when instructed to abort.
We took a roundabout route to HOMEPLATE as FL wanted to take the runway with ILS support due to the rough weather. Unfortunately we were still too heavy with all our bombs and Fisty & Mango put it down too hard and crashed on landing. Fortunately, I'd cleared the runway before my frame exploded, leaving it clear for Poppy to execute a perfect inclement landing (don't you just hate that!) <- Just kidding mate :D

Oops, I almost forgot - MF since we didn't make it to the AO.

Zipgun Posted - 18 Sep 2016 : 23:05:57
Simply stated, there were 3 threat vectors in this mission, we had planned for 2 -- NE and NW threats -- the SW escort that engaged Fury was a complete surprise. We lost cohesion and as Poppy put it- we went from a 4 ship to 2 two ships, to 3 one ships -- this is how you loose control of the sky which we did.

Utopic - 0 0 Rs
Tank - 2 0 RTB
Zipgun - 5 0 RS (fuel flame out)
Wildcat - 1 0 RTB

IMHO: I think we should try to engage fixed infrastructure targets in the west, along the line toward Pyongyang. This will keep us from being flanked (as much) because our noses will be pointed toward the red airbases. We lost 4 airframes tonight, that's a going-out-of-business curve. If we clear a path to juicy targets by loading a mission or two with 2x SEAD/DEAD and 1x Escort we can strategically approach high value C&C, Supply, and Army targets that will drop their supply score and get us on the offensive.
Veiland Posted - 18 Sep 2016 : 21:52:08
Flight Role: SEAD
Fury31: "Veiland" AA=1 AG=1 RTB
Fury32: "Floyd" AA=2 AG=0 RTB
Fury33: "Griffin" AA=0 AG=0 TECH
Fury34: "Zohrs" AA=1 AG=0 RTB

Lost Griffin to a technical right after takeoff.
Moved across the flot with escort flight. Fired on SA11 on flightpath as briefed (PPT 61) and turned cold. After calling this on UHF 6 we got the call from Escort that multiple hostiles were inbound and that we should retrogade well south of the flot. On the Flot we got flanked by MIG-29's (or whatever they were) and I had one MIG-29 jump from outer to inner circle and launch a missile at me. In the end we were able to outrun them.
Well south of the Flot we turned north, as Zipgun recommended to abort the package and requested someone else to take over package command as he were about to run out fuel.
Fury took package command and told everyone to RTB while trying to cover the remnants of the escort flight, killing 4xSU-25 presenting themselves.
Plenty of confusion ...
Edit:
There seemed to be problems with the ini file in SEAD flight. Basicly our flightplan ended halfway between the flot and the targer area. I would recommend for the future only to include a test file with PPT points for copy paste, rather than a complete .ini file.
utopic Posted - 18 Sep 2016 : 21:35:26
Flight Role: ESCORT
Falcon11: "Utopic" AA=0 AG=0 EJT
Falcon12: "Tank" AA=0 AG=0 RTB
Falcon13: "Zipgun" AA=0 AG=0 EJT
Falcon14: "Wildcat" AA=0 AG=0 RTB

On the way to the target, Cowboy called us about some bandits left of scope, we turned to investigate, but didn't find them, and at some point they (Cowboy) also lost them.

We then returned to the flight plan, and while approaching the flot, the first element started monitoring a bandit on the east coast, of no factor. We then started a grinder south of the flot, while Fury engaged their first target.

A 2ship mig 29 was engaged by the 2nd element and the route was clear for a minute.

From that moment on, things turned sour: our 2nd element started to engage another group coming from NE, and Tank spotted another group coming from NE.

I turned cold and called a regroup for my flight, then also asked all flights to retrograde south of the flot, which I think they did.

At this point, my #2 had a 29 on his six, asked for a delouse, I was cold, turned to support, couldn't find the bandit, and got shot down.

Zipgun, if you could post the next part of the story...
